Mattias Björnmalm is a scholar working on Biomaterials, Biomedical Engineering and Surfaces, Coatings and Films. According to data from OpenAlex, Mattias Björnmalm has authored 48 papers receiving a total of 5.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Biomaterials, 18 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 14 papers in Surfaces, Coatings and Films. Recurrent topics in Mattias Björnmalm’s work include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ery (13 papers), Polymer Surface Interaction Studies (12 papers)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(6 papers). Mattias Björnmalm is often cited by papers focused on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ery (13 papers), Polymer Surface Interaction Studies (12 papers)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(6 papers). Mattias Björnmalm coll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United Kingdom and Japan. Mattias Björnmalm's co-authors include Frank Caruso, Joseph J. Richardson, Jiwei Cui, Julia A. Braunger, Hirotaka Ejima, Matthew Faria, Yan Yan, Kristian Kempe, Nadja Bertleff‐Zieschang and Kristofer J. Thurecht and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Chemical Reviews and Journal of the American Chemical Society.
